Entries Judged on Aesthetic, Technical Aspects A panel of experts judged each entry on a variety of criteria, such as design and technique; technical use of software and system capabilities; innovative and imaginative use of Intergraph Process, Power & Offshore software; and aesthetic screen display or plot of the finished art including composition, layout and use of color. About Intergraph Process, Power & Offshore With nearly a quarter century of industry experience, Intergraph Process, Power & Offshore enables customers to create, capture and manage plant information as a strategic asset by providing integrated life cycle solutions for the engineering, design, construction and operation of process and power plants as well as offshore oil and gas facilities. Core brands include the SmartPlant(R) and PDS(TM) (Plant Design System) suites, the SmartPlant Foundation lifecycle engineering information management and MARIAN(R) materials, procurement and supply chain management solutions. Intergraph Process, Power & Offshore (www.intergraph.com/ppo) is the acknowledged global leader in the plant creation market (Source: Daratech Inc.). A division of Intergraph Corporation, Process, Power & Offshore is headquartered in Huntsville, Ala. USA, employs more than 700 people and does business in more than 60 countries.
